The fundamental mission of ICAN is to provide a voice for Idahoans committed to progressive social change and to develop the power necessary to create those changes. We are dedicated to the following principles:

 

* Empowerment of disenfranchised people and development of new leadership. We recognize that empowerment may mean different things to each of us. However, we share a commitment to developing community, acquiring and using skills, reinforcing active involvement, developing a common sense of responsibility and taking action for change.

 

* Everyone is welcome to participate - we are steadfastly dedicated to diversity.

 

* A stable, membership-driven funding base.

 

* The democratic process within and outside the organization.

 

* Non-violent action in the spirit of Gandhi and Martin Luther King, Jr. These activities may include direct action, rallies, lobbying, public education research, street theater or community meetings.

 

* ICAN´s members elect the ICAN Board of Directors, which sets policy for the organization.
